Synagogue Skills 101 with Rabbi Cantor
Tuesday evenings, 6:30-8pm, November 1st through mid-May
Three privileges of being a Jewish adult (“bar/bat mitzvah”) are leading services, chanting scripture, and teaching Torah.
Classes in leading the weekday and Sabbath prayer services with understanding, Torah reading, and how to compose and deliver a D’var Torah. At the conclusion of the course, participants will be eligible to celebrate an “Adult Bar/Bat Mitzvah.”
Reading Hebrew is a prerequisite for this course
